in the USASpring Arbor University is a very small not-for-profit college offering many disciplines along with the environmental program and located in
Spring Arbor,
Michigan. The college was founded in 1873 and is presently offering bachelor's degrees in Environmental Science.
Spring Arbor University is expensive - depending on the program, tuition varies around $34,000 per year. If you look for a cheaper alternative, check
